SUVs have emerged as the dominant force for most American families when it comes to purchasing a dependable and practical family servant. In a market once controlled by the sedan, SUVs have taken over due to providing more practicality thanks to their hatchback-style tailgates and higher rooflines that improve interior comfort and space, while also being more convenient due to their higher ride heights. Not only does this make them generally safer in the event of a crash, but it also means parents don’t have to lean down to tend to their children in the back seat.
